Colombia’s Top Court Freezes Online Gambling Tax Hike
The Constitutional Court of Colombia has stepped in to block a tax increase on online gambling, delivering a significant blow to President Gustavo Petro’s financial plans. The decision, reached by a 6-2 majority, provisionally suspends Legislative Decree 1390 of 2025, which envisioned a 19% value-added tax on online betting and gambling services.
